Tips when counting inventory cycles

To consider the seasonality, it is important to have a response of a certain product when it is in season where its sale is high, it is a waste of time and effort to have a product that will not have immediate mobility.

You can choose to count in cycle by department, supplier, type of product, the brand, among others, depends on personal criteria and what makes the most sense for the business. Regardless of the method, the key is to maintain a certain order, establish a systematic procedure, organize and document it, to avoid errors.

Implement the use of tools that allow greater efficiency and allow to quickly detect problems, use an inventory management software for this work.

Reorganize the physical space properly to implement true inventory control. This involves organizing the items on shelves, establishing an order and site for each product in addition to the corresponding labeling.

Keep up to date, restocking, timely handling of reserve material.

It is important to keep track of purchase orders in system and physical.

Count the products, double check the numbers and keep the system up to date.

After counting, the records should be reviewed, adjusted and determined the course of the actions to come.

Assume that you purchase a 6-year, 8% certificate of deposit for $1,000. If interest is compounded annually, what will be the va
Dmitry [639]

Answer:

$ 1,586.8743

Explanation:

Calculation to determine what will be the value of the certificate when it matures

Compounded annually

Principal P= 1000

Rate r=0.08

Period n = 6

Using this formula

A = P (1+r)^n

Let plug in the formula

1000 (1.08)^6

= 1586.8743

Therefore what will be the value of the certificate when it matures is $1586.8743
